Admission

All applicants should have a two-year associate's degree in a technical field, plus two or more years of technical work experience.

 

Transfer Credit

The Bachelor of Science in Managment degree at UW-Stout is a degree completion program for people who possess associate degrees and professional work experience. Students who transfer from an accredited two- or four-year college can apply earned credits to the program. University requirements dictate all students complete a minimum of 32 credits from UW-Stout.
